Output 6cdafdb2ff592d94ffdf903a8e2865e71f097d053b58db0bcab88b3ee7878935:1

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db99c4ad6e7a70c88ee299dde5e929d53539c50 OP_EQUAL
address
3BhBvu3PQenMHq531kKTqMrH897rNpseYu
transaction
6cdafdb2ff592d94ffdf903a8e2865e71f097d053b58db0bcab88b3ee7878935
confirmations
5379
spent
true